Bio

Dr. Stephen Bates earned his medical degree from McMaster University in 1979 and entered a residency in Family Medicine. In 1984, he completed his residency in Obstetrics & Gynecology and began his general practice in Obstetrics & Gynecology, including colposcopy, laser surgery of the genital tract, hysteroscopy, endometrial ablation and operative laparoscopy. In 1994 he completed his MSc in Clinical Epidemiology and Biostatistics at McMaster University.

In addition to his practice in Brantford, Dr. Bates has dedicated his career to education, working as a Clinical Professor in the Department of Obstetrics and Gynecology at McMaster University. 

Awards

His teaching of health professionals at all levels has earned him numerous awards including the Association of Professors of Obstetrics and Gynecology (Canada) Educator of the Year Award in 2006, the Faculty of Health Sciences Undergraduate MD Program Outstanding Preceptor Award in 2007 and the 2008 CREOG National Faculty Award for Excellence in Resident Education.
